Experimental study on self-restoring of magnetic fluid seal

Abstract

Magnetic fluid seal has the self-restoring capacity after bursting. The anti-pressure capacity of magnetic fluid seal after restoring is important for application. The self-restoring process was observed. The influences of the increasing rate of pressure, the bursting times of magnetic fluid seal, the magnetic field gradient under sealing teeth, the number of sealing teeth on magnetic poles and the number of magnetic poles for the anti-pressure capacity of restored magnetic fluid seal were studied. Some conclusions valuable for increasing the self-restoring capacity of magnetic fluid seal were summarized.
